Purpose

Gatorade Sports Science Institute (GSSI) aims to support the ECSS Virtual Congress 2021 with an award that fosters professional development for students in the fields of sports nutrition.

Award

Three winners will each receive Two Thousand Euros (2.000 €) to cover registration costs for the ECSS Virtual Congress 2021 (September 8-10, 2021) and to use for other professional development per the winner’s discretion. Additionally, winners will also each receive:

  • An opportunity to meet with a GSSI scientist to discuss research interests and career advice
  • An invitation to GSSI’s virtual Expert Panel (XP) meeting in October 2021

Criteria

    • Applicant must be an ECSS member and registered for the ECSS Virtual Congress 2021. ECSS will confirm candidate’s ECSS membership and Annual Meeting registration prior to review and determination of Upon selection for award, recipient will be required to submit proof of citizenship (copy of passport or other valid ID).

    • Applicant must be a young researcher working in the field of sports nutrition and hydration and apply by submitting the following:
      - An online application form (including CV and Letter of Motivation)
      - Two letters of recommendation
      - An abstract to the ECSS

    • The researcher must be currently studying sports nutrition or within five years of completing PhD in sports nutrition

    • Letter of Motivation Details
      - Applicant will submit a written statement detailing their professional goals and describing how a professional development award will help them meet their future career in exercise physiology and/or sports nutrition (300-word limit). Evaluation of the written statement will be based on clearly defined goals related to the field of exercise physiology and/or sports nutrition and demonstration of how receiving a professional development grant will help further his/her studies and/or professional development. The statement must also incorporate what they’ve learned about the research process or how it has impacted their academic career thus far.
